About the Leadership Council
The EMM Leadership Council is a program founded by Edmond Mobile Meals to create awareness of social issues and inspire leadership among students in the Edmond community.
This training program addresses fundamental leadership skills and self-reflection. The interactive sessions focus on leading with collaboration, adaptability, and compassion and provides hands-on experiences in real projects for a nonprofit organization. The work of this council has a direct impact on the well-being of vulnerable individuals in our community.

Program Details:
- Length – Six session training program beginning in October 2022 through April 2023.
- Meetings – Meetings are once per month from 4:00pm-6:00pm
- Acceptance – sophomore, junior, and senior level students at local public, private and home-based schools may apply.

Program Benefits to the Student:
- Practical experience to help them better understand issues facing today’s leaders.
- A chance to meet other peer leaders who are looking to have influence.
- Insight into how different personality styles impact leadership and learning.
- Direct leadership coaching with a certified executive trainer.
- Custom DISC personality assessment with personal guidance in each student’s strengths and opportunities for growth.
- Volunteer hours to meet NHS requirements.
- Recommendation letters from community leaders for college applications.
- Personal fulfillment as a result of helping those in need in our community.
